China is dominating hotel development in Asia with India a distant second.
The hotel development pipeline in Asia Pacific comprises 1,104 hotels totalling 276,544 rooms, according to the January 2011 STR Global Construction Pipeline Report released on Friday.
China ended the month with 101,118 rooms in the ‘In Construction’ phase – more than half of the region’s total.
Other countries that reported a large number of rooms under development include India (31,104 rooms), Thailand (8,089), Vietnam (7,277), and Indonesia (5,103).
“China and India have the most rooms under construction across the Asia Pacific region, which reflects the interest by international and regional chains to. cater to the growing number of domestic and international visitors in these strategic markets”, said Elizabeth Randall, Managing Director of STR Global.
